Acreage Clearing in Houston, TX

Acreage clearing services involve removing trees, brush, stumps, and other vegetation from large plots of land to prepare them for development, agriculture, or landscaping projects. This process is essential for property owners who need open, level space for building new structures, installing driveways, planting crops, or creating recreational areas. These services typically cover a range of projects, including site preparation for residential developments, farmland expansion, or the creation of outdoor spaces on rural or suburban properties. Property owners should consider factors such as the size of the area, types of vegetation present, and any local regulations or permits required before requesting acreage clearing.

Before requesting acreage clearing,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including what vegetation will be removed and how debris will be managed. It’s also important to clarify whether stumps will be ground or removed and if any grading or leveling will be part of the process. Knowing the extent of clearing needed helps determine the equipment and resources required, ensuring the project aligns with property goals. Clear communication about the land’s current condition and future plans can facilitate a smooth and efficient clearing process.

Project Types

Common Acreage Clearing Jobs

Land clearing - removing trees, shrubs, and debris to prepare a property for development or landscaping.

Brush removal - clearing overgrown vegetation to improve safety and aesthetic appeal.

Tree removal - safely cutting down hazardous or unwanted trees to protect property and landscape.

Stump grinding - eliminating tree stumps to create a smooth, usable yard surface.

Lot clearing - clearing large areas for new construction, farming, or recreational use.

Vegetation management - controlling invasive plants and maintaining a healthy, manageable landscape.

FAQ

Acreage Clearing Questions

What types of land are suitable for acreage clearing? Acreage clearing is ideal for residential lots, farmland, and properties needing brush removal or tree thinning to prepare for development or landscaping.

What equipment is used for acreage cl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and skid steers are commonly used to efficiently clear large areas of land.

What should property owners consider before clearing land? It's important to evaluate the land's terrain, access points, and any local regulations or permits required for land modification.

Is acreage clearing suitable for removing specific trees or brush? Yes, the service can target and remove unwanted trees, shrubs, and dense underbrush to improve land usability and appearance.
